Why in the world do they have to make the hood open with such close tolerance to the brush guard
Back a couple months ago I was using a rear blade on the loader to unload some trailer loads of dirt, I bumped the rub rail a few times with the brush guard, went to open the hood a few weeks later and it hit hit the guard after only opening a few inches. After looks it over I found that it bent the ends of the mounting plate were both up rights are mounted. For now I have just loosened the mounting bolts and allowed the guard to lean out away from the hood enough to allow clearance the couple of times I've needed to open it. Not sure just yet what I'm going to do, I could just bend it back with little work but if it got bumped again I'd be right back were I am now. Been looking at different designs and may build a new one.
